The forest is the original play station! This 1.5-hour guided nature adventure through the biodiverse Lyon Arboretum always leads to fun discoveries and interactions. Unlike other naturalist education programs, the emphasis on a forest bathing walk is to engage your senses, including the imagination -- with the hope of building a lifelong love for the natural world.

Mobility requirement: must be able to walk unassisted on uneven ground with slight inclines; raise and lower oneself from sitting; be able to sit and stand on the ground for 15 minutes.
Recommend wearing long sleeve shirt and long pants to protect against the sun and mosquitoes, also close-toed shoes with good traction and socks above the ankles. Also wear hat, sunglasses. Bring a small backpack to carry your items and to keep hands free for exploring. Before the walk begins, apply fragrance-free mosquito repellent (DEET or Picaridin are the only effective types).
Walk does proceed when it's raining, unless weather is hazardous. Bring a rain jacket or water-repellent poncho.
Minimum age: 5 years old. Children must be accompanied by an adult.
